A home appraiser is a qualified, licensed professional who can accurately estimate the fair market value of your Publishers Clearing House home. By taking information about your home and combining it with information about your Publishers Clearing House neighborhood and homes that have sold in the area, a real estate appraiser can give you a clear picture of your home value. Other than a home appraiser, the only professional who is able to provide information about the value of your home are real estate agents. A real estate agent is not always the best source for this information. After all a real estate agent works off of commissions and it is in their best interests to sell your home either as quickly as possible or for as much money as possible.
